The Clemson Tiger Cub has done the ALS Ice Bucket Challenge on Saturday. The Tiger Cub has nominated Clemson Mens' Golf, CU Pinkgorilla and Clemson president Jim Clements for the ALS Ice Bucket Challenge.
The Challenge is for them to either pour a bucket of ice water over their head and/or make a donation to fight ALS within 24 hours. Since July 29th, The ALS association has received 11.4 million in donations compared to only $1.12 million from the same time last year.
